    Complaint statuses

    Resolved:
    The complainant verified the issue was resolved to their satisfaction.
    Unresolved:
    The business responded to the dispute but failed to make a good faith effort to resolve it.
    Answered:
    The business addressed the issues within the complaint, but the consumer either a) did not accept the response, OR b) did not notify BBB as to their satisfaction.
    Unanswered:
    The business failed to respond to the dispute.
    Unpursuable:
    BBB is unable to locate the business.
    Attended business on July 29th 2022 for hair colouring services. Services were not as requested (did something totally different than what was agreed upon). They were argumentative and then agreed to attempt to correct the colour, resulting in damage to hair. The hair was not fixed and is now more difficult and costly to correct (I will be going elsewhere). I immediately (within hours) tried to contact an owner or manager - via both email and phone. They would not speak to me. When I called today (November 25th) they tell me that the stylist no longer works there and I would have to call the salon she now works at and they would have to give me a refund. This was $292.50 and point of sales receipt shows their business information. The claim they were not the ones who actually charged me because the stylist was on commission at the time. I stated my receipt shows your business name so it is not the stylist personally nor their new employer who would issue a refund - in that case, I said I would contact my credit company if this was not a legitimate transaction. The woman on the phone made a vague threat about telling them that I was lying and then she hung up. I have blocked this business on my phone and email, but my issue is still left unresolved, and I would go as far as to say I was ******* by this business. I would need to recover my money because next time I have to get my hair coloured (taking a break for a while due to the damage caused), it will cost extra to get the mistakes corrected. Other important notes: they repeatedly ******* my phone with unsolicited marketing, and also during the appointment I was left in a dark room alone uncomfortably with my head bent over backwards into a sink for extended periods of time (that's dangerous).
